What most people miss: the deep fragility of multi-vendor systems
Here's the thing: an audio system isn't just a list of components. It's a chain of mechanical, electrical, and acoustic dependencies. One weak link — say, an Isoacoustics stand that doesn't match the speaker's weight rating — and the whole setup becomes unstable. Not just physically, but sonically.
Let me walk you through what I found that night.
The first trap: compatibility assumptions
The client had already ordered a Bose satellite speaker pair and assumed any stand would work. They bought a generic floor stand. The speakers wobbled. We had to swap to Isoacoustics ISO-200s — designed specifically for heavier monitors — but the order didn't arrive until Friday afternoon. That left zero buffer for testing.
I don't have hard data on how many rushed setups fail because of stand mismatches, but based on my last 60+ emergency calls, I'd say roughly one in five has a mounting or height issue. That's a lot of preventable rework.
The second trap: the mixer that doesn't play well with others
Digico audio mixers are powerful. But they require specific digital routing and often a DSP configuration that an in-house AV guy might not have done before. The client's technician had never used a Digico before. He assumed it was 'just another mixer.'
Honestly, I'm not sure why some brands make their configuration so opaque. My best guess is it's a trade-off: flexibility for complexity. But when you're on a deadline, that complexity becomes a ticking time bomb.

The solution is simpler than you think (and I wish I'd realized it sooner)
After three years of these scrambles, I finally changed my approach. Instead of jumping to order gear, I now spend the first 20% of the time mapping the entire chain — every component, every physical connection, every compatibility point. Then I apply a standard checklist that covers:
- Speaker-stand weight rating and twist-lock compatibility (e.g., does the Bose satellite have a standard 1⅜" pole mount? Not always.)
- Mixer digital protocol matching (Digico often uses Dante or AES; does the venue have compatible network?)
- Power conditioning — especially for Copenhagen loudspeaker company's active monitors, which are sensitive to voltage dips.
- Rush supplier lead times verified before committing to the client.
Granted, this requires more front-end work. But it cuts the chance of last-minute crises by about 70%. I've seen it in the data. We used to average 1.2 emergency calls per quarter; now it's down to 0.3.
Look, I'm not saying budget options are always bad. I'm saying they're riskier when the clock is ticking. A pair of Isoacoustics ISO-200 stands costs around $250 (as of January 2025; verify current prices). That's less than what you'd pay for a rushed replacement and the stress that comes with it.
